Output 623df9e99036980e96aab08150b8838592b9b59d9555d6726892790586c3ec93:2

value
242455823
script pubkey
OP_0 OP_PUSHBYTES_20 d3ae1345f9748d5f2b1bb119e03fa63037708107
address
bc1q6whpx30ewjx472cmkyv7q0axxqmhpqg8c6pw9p
transaction
623df9e99036980e96aab08150b8838592b9b59d9555d6726892790586c3ec93
confirmations
104720
spent
true